FULLBEAUTY Brands Recalls Children's Nightgowns Due to Violation of Federal Flammability Standard
WASHINGTON, D.C. - The U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ission, in cooperation with the firm named below, today announced a voluntary recall of the following consumer product. Consumers should stop using recalled products immediately unless otherwise instructed. It is illegal to resell or attempt to resell a recalled consumer product.
Name of product: Children's nightgowns
Hazard: The nightgowns fail to meet federal flammability standards for children's sleepwear, posing a risk of burn injuries to children.
Remedy: Refund
Consumer Contact: FULLBEAUTY Brands at 800-313-8803 from 8:30 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. ET Monday through Friday, email fbbrecall@fbbrands.com or online at www.fbbrands.com and click on Recall Information for more information.
Units: About 31,500
Description: This recall involves girl's Dreams & Co.® by FULLBEAUTY Brands knit cotton jersey "daughter Henley" styled nightgown. The nightgowns have picot edge trim and a button placket on the center front of the chest. The nightgowns were sold in children's sizes: 6/6X, 7/8 and 10/12 in the following five different prints. The style number is printed on the side seam label of the nightgown.

Incidents/Injuries: None reported
Remedy: Consumers should immediately take the recalled nightgowns away from children and contact the firm for instructions on receiving a full refund or a company gift card for 125% of the purchase price. The firm is contacting consumers that purchased the recalled nightgowns.
Sold exclusively at: www.Amazon.com, www.jessicalondon, www.roamans.com and www.womanwithin.com from August 2009 through July 2016 for between $13 and $20.
Importer: FULLBEAUTY Brands L.P., of New York
Manufactured in: Pakistan
